To add a taste of Ireland to your life, try your hand at these traditional Irish recipes to share with friends and family. Erin Go Bragh!
This recipe from Countryside Cravings uses just four ingredients! Serve the bread with butter or jam, with an egg or with hearty soups and stews.
Colcannon is an Irish recipe that combines green cabbage, potatoes and bacon for a comforting side dish. Top it with corned beef for a perfect Irish feast. Try this colcannon recipe from Spend with Pennies.
The Daring Gourmet shares a traditional Irish beef stew recipe that includes Guinness Extra Stout. This rich and hearty stew will stick to your ribs!
The Life Jolie provides a recipe for classic corned beef and cabbage that can be prepared in a slow cooker or a pressure cooker. The tender beef is accompanied by cabbage, potatoes, carrots and onions for a flavorful meal.
These simple and delicious potato pancakes are traditionally served with breakfast but would make a great side dish for any meal. 31 Daily shares this recipe that can be whipped up in no time.
